Soul Snack 209/11 ... Life's Scenery

Could you paint a landscape of your life's path now?

Would the path be the centre of this artwork?

Would the path snake forward or flee backward?

What choices did you make at the various intersections?

Were these intersections met in light, grey or darkness?

What scenery would your path course through - a desert with scattered blooms, a dark ocean of monstrous waves or maybe an eden? How often would this scenery change?

Whatever scenery accompanied your path of life the scenery that salvation brings is so far superior.

Then I saw a new heaven and a new earth, for the first heaven and the first earth had passed away, and there was no longer any sea. I saw the Holy City, the new Jerusalem, coming down out of heaven from God, prepared as a bride beautifully dressed for her husband. (Rev 20:1-2)

The destination is worth the difficulty of the journey.
